草庐IT

CALENDAR

全部标签

android - 如何从android中的指定日期获取日期

假设我的日期是02-01-2013它存储在一个变量中,例如:StringstrDate="02-01-2013";那我应该如何得到这个日期的日期(即星期二)? 最佳答案 使用Calendar来自javaapi的类。Calendarcalendar=newGregorianCalendar(2008,01,01);//NotethatMonthvalueis0-based.e.g.,0forJanuary.intreslut=calendar.get(Calendar.DAY_OF_WEEK);switch(result){caseC

java - Android-从 DatePickerDialogFragment 中删除 Calendarview

我有一个工作正常的Datepickerdialogfragment。当我单击按钮时,datepickerdialog打开,左侧有微调器日期选择,右侧有日历View。对于我在一个地方的应用程序,我只想单独显示微调器日期选择部分(必须删除或隐藏日历View部分)在其他地方,我希望必须显示日历View部分并且必须隐藏或删除微调器日期选择。但我尝试了很多不同的东西,比如隐藏日历ViewMethodm=minDateSelector.getClass().getMethod("setCalendarViewShown",boolean.class);m.invoke(dp,false);但是当我

android - 如何在 Android 中减去两个日历对象

例如,我有两个格式为“MM/dd/yyyy”的日历对象。我如何减去它们并返回天数?例如,“9/7/2014”-“9/1/2014”并返回7。Calendarcalendar=Calendar.getInstance();Calendartoday=Calendar.getInstance(); 最佳答案 你可以这样尝试:Calendarcalendar=Calendar.getInstance();calendar.set(Calendar.DAY_OF_MONTH,7);calendar.set(Calendar.MONTH,8)

android - 在选定的时间和日期设置闹钟

我正在Android2.1上开发任务管理器。我想为日期选择器的日期和时间选择器的时间设置的任务设置闹钟帮助我编写代码..public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.main);finalEditTextnext=(EditText)findViewById(R.id.editText1);finalButtonsub=(Button)findViewById(R.id.button1);finalButtonres=(But

java - 如何获得月份的捷克名称

我在使用我的语言-捷克语获取月份名称时遇到问题。我想把月份名称作为名词,但我总是得到变形的标题。我尝试了很多方法来获取名字,但所有方法都返回月份名称的变形标题例如,我想用捷克语“Říjen”获取十月的名称,但我总是得到“října”。Calendarcal=Calendar.getInstance();SimpleDateFormatmonth_date=newSimpleDateFormat("MMMMMMMMM");Stringmonth_name=month_date.format(cal.getTime());DateFormatformatData=newSimpleDate

android - 警报管理器未在 android 中的确切时间触发警报

我使用如下日历类安排闹钟Calendarcal=Calendar.getInstance();cal.set(Calendar.HOUR_OF_DAY,1);cal.getTimeInMillis();cal.set(Calendar.MINUTE,05);longTriggerMillis=cal.getTimeInMillis();AlarmManageraManager=(AlarmManager)context.getSystemService(Context.ALARM_SERVICE);aManager.set(AlarmManager.RTC_WAKEUP,Trigger

android - 获取当前日期作为字符串警告已弃用 toGmtString() 问题

我想在Android中获取当前日期日/月/年分:秒,所以我使用了以下代码Stringdata="";Calendarc=Calendar.getInstance();data=c.getTime().toGMTString();但是Eclipse通知我方法.toGMTString();已被弃用。如何避免使用这种已弃用的方法来获取格式化字符串的当前日期? 最佳答案 来自Android文档:Thismethodisdeprecated.useDateFormat由于GMT字符串表示为22Jun199913:02:00GMT,我们可以使用

android - 如何使用日历 Intent ?

我正在尝试从我的应用程序启动日历,这样我就可以让用户将他们的约会放入其中,然后让我的应用程序读取这些内容。我尝试了我在这里找到的一段代码:ComponentNamecn;Intenti=newIntent();cn=newComponentName("com.google.android.calendar","com.android.calendar.LaunchActivity");i.setComponent(cn);startActivity(i);得到错误07-0721:05:33.944:ERROR/AndroidRuntime(1089):Causedby:android.

java - 将整数日期/时间转换为 Java 中的 unix 时间戳?

这主要适用于android,但也可以用于Java。我有这些听众:intyear,month,day,hour,minute;//thecallbackreceivedwhentheuser"sets"thedateinthedialogprivateDatePickerDialog.OnDateSetListenermDateSetListener=newDatePickerDialog.OnDateSetListener(){publicvoidonDateSet(DatePickerview,intyear,intmonthOfYear,intdayOfMonth){year=ye

android - 删除谷歌日历中的单次事件

我想删除重复事件的单次出现。这是我的代码:privatevoidhandleActionDelete(longevent,longoccurrence){finalContentResolvercontentResolver=getContentResolver();Uri.BuildereventsUriBuilder=CalendarContract.Instances.CONTENT_URI.buildUpon();ContentUris.appendId(eventsUriBuilder,Long.MIN_VALUE);ContentUris.appendId(eventsUr